Physical Properties of Pyroaurite
Cleavage:
{0001} Perfect
Color:
Brownish yellow, Brown white, Colorless, Greenish, Yellowish white.
Density:
2.07
Diaphaneity:
Transparent
Fracture:
Flexible - Flexible fragments.
Habit:
Fibrous - Crystals made up of fibers.
Habit:
Tabular - Form dimensions are thin in one direction.
Hardness:
2.5 - Finger Nail
Luster:
Pearly
Streak:
white
Optical Properties of Pyroaurite
Gladstone-Dale:
CI meas= 0.025 (Excellent) - where the CI = (1-KPDmeas/KC) CI calc= 0.052 (Good) - where the CI = (1-KPDcalc/KC)
KPDcalc= 0.2599,KPDmeas= 0.2674,KC= 0.2742 Ncalc = 1.57 - 1.58
Optical Data:
Uniaxial (-), e=1.543, w=1.564, bire=0.0210.
